Relationship between seminal LDH-C4 and spermatozoa with acrosome anomalies.
1997
Abstract Lactate dehydrogenase C 4 (LDH-C 4 ), the specific isozyme of LDH produced by germ cells, was assessed in the seminal plasma of 55 patients to test a potential link between LDH-C 4 and the count per ml of spermatozoa with acrosome anomalies. A simple regression curve shows a statistically significant positive correlation between seminal LDH-C 4 concentrations and count per ml of spermatozoa with acrosome anomalies ( r = + 0.640, P 4 concentrations and sperm motility. Though seminal LDH-C 4 thus seems to be a poor indirect marker of energy produced by spermatozoa, in contrast, this LDH isozyme may be a useful indirect marker of acrosome anomalies.
